Description
THIS MOD IS REQUIRED TO BE ABOVE REAL SONAR, NEUROTRAUMA, AND MY OTHER MOD IF USED: REAL SONAR MEDICAL ITEM RECIPES PATCH FOR NEUROTRAUMA IN YOUR MOD LIST TO PROPERLY FUNCTION.

Known bug: when applying plasma for the first time during a round, it can sometimes cause blood pressure to plummet instantly. Unknown why this happens, but the blood pressure normalizes itself shortly, assuming there's not other factors preventing it

This mod adds the ability to deconstruct blood bags into blood plasma and red blood cell cultures. Blood plasma only inherits the blood type letter, red blood cell cultures inherit the blood type letter and the + or -

You can then combine compatible blood plasma types with red blood cell cultures of your desired blood type to craft new blood bags in the medical fabricator, essentially converting blood bag types.

Red blood cell cultures can be grown to multiply themselves x3 with saline, alien blood, and 25% of a dementonite.

Blood plasma compatability roughly reflects real life plasma compatibility, which is mostly the opposite of blood bag compatibility:
AB plasma is the universal donor and can be combined with all RBC types
A plasma is compatible with A and O RBC cultures
B plasma is compatible with B and O RBC cultures
O plasma is only compatible with O RBC cultures

Blood plasma can be used as a medicine with several effects:
  • Doubles healing rate for first and second degree burns on the whole body, stacking with bandages
  • Stabilizes blood Ph (reduces both acidosis and alkalosis)
  • Raises blood pressure by roughly 30% (the same as ringer's solution)
  • Temporarily stops sepsis from increasing
  • Temporarily stops liver failure from causing neurotrauma

These effects are roughly equivalent to what plasma transfusions are used for IRL, though within the confines of what neurotrauma afflictions allow in regards to accuracy to IRL.

Applying an incorrect plasma type to a patient will cause a half strength hemotransfusion shock.

Blood plasma infusions will show on the hematology analyzer.

You can now deconstruct blood plasma and red blood cell cultures into saline and stabilozine, respectively, following how neurotrauma blood packs deconstruct into the same items. Now you can get rid of those annoying extra RBC cultures taking up space and turn them into useful ingredients.

Dornam  [author] 7 Nov, 2023 @ 1:23pm 
It probably has to do with how vanilla blood packs are converted to neurotrauma blood packs when they spawn, and directly spawning them with commands might not do that properly.

Why are you making plasma reduce blood loss? IRL, plasma can't actually replace red blood cells, seeing as it missing the red blood cells is what makes it a bag of plasma instead of blood.

Bloodloss in neurotrauma represents missing RBC + blood volume, while blood pressure is only the liquid volume in your veins, so while bloodloss and blood pressure are related, they're not directly the same. If you don't have enough red blood cells, your body can't distribute oxygen properly, even if there is proper blood pressure, which is why blood plasma shouldn't help cure blood loss, only raise blood pressure, since it doesn't have red blood cells in it.
